Choosing the correct ice melting salt calls for knowing your specific needs and the fundamentals behind the materials. Various ice melters work equally in frigid conditions, and certain types can damage concrete or landscaping if not applied properly. You should choose a solution that becomes effective quickly, maintains effectiveness at low temperatures, and applies uniformly for even coverage. Calcium chloride, magnesium chloride, and treated rock salts all have distinct characteristics—calcium chloride, for example, dissolves ice at far lower temperatures and produces an exothermic reaction, creating its own heat. This means, even in below-freezing conditions, salt application can break the ice bond and provide enhanced traction.
Effective winter safety starts with taking preventive measures. Don't wait until snow accumulates—apply salt before freezing conditions arrive. Pre-treatment helps prevent ice from adhering to surfaces, making subsequent removal significantly easier and reducing overall salt usage. This strategy saves money while protecting the environment, decreasing salt contamination in surrounding water bodies. Proper salt storage and handling are essential for winter safety. Maintain your salt in dry, covered conditions to stop clumping which impacts even distribution. Use properly calibrated equipment to ensure accurate application—using too much wastes resources and potentially damages pavement and vegetation, while using too little results in dangerous surface conditions. Is Ice Melting Salt Safe for Pets and Children
While using ice melting salt, you need to be mindful of pet safety and child protection. Some salts can irritate paws or skin and could be dangerous when swallowed. Choose products labeled as safe for pets and children to minimize risks. Always follow the manufacturer's instructions, apply only what's needed, and store salt out of reach. Wash surfaces and clean animal paws after exposure to minimize possible risks and keep your family safe.
What's the Best Way to Store Ice Melting Salt?
Consider storing ice melting salt as though safeguarding a seasonal necessity—keep it potent and safe. You'll want to use sealed containers and stash them in a moisture-free area to prevent clumping and maintain effectiveness. Adhere to storage guidelines including keeping salt away from moisture and out of direct sunlight. For safety precautions, store it out of reach of pets and children, and keep it separate from food and animal feed to eliminate potential contamination.
Will Ice Melting Salt Eventually Expire or Lose Potency
Many people ask if ice melting salt expires or loses effectiveness. Due to its high chemical stability, ice melting salt generally has a long shelf life and won't actually expire. However, improper storage—like contact with moisture—can cause solidification, making it harder to spread but not the salt's effectiveness. To preserve maximum efficiency, you should maintain it in a moisture-proof, sealed container, guaranteeing the most effective solution for managing ice.
Can Ice Melting Salt Harm Concrete or Pavement?
Consider persistent pellets pounding your pavement—it's true, ice melting salt can damage your pavement over time. When you spread salt, you're hastening material breakdown, especially on aging or permeable surfaces. Salt penetrates surface fissures, increases temperature-related stress, and could weaken surface stability. To protect your property, opt for surface-friendly solutions and strictly adhere to usage guidelines. Applying protective sealants helps minimize damage and ensures lasting performance.
Are There Eco-Friendly Ice Melting Options Available?
Yes, you'll find eco friendly substitutes to traditional ice melting salt. Consider using biodegradable de icers containing materials like calcium magnesium acetate or potassium acetate. These products naturally decompose, reducing harm to flora, ground, and aquatic environments. You can discover options that deliver effective ice control while minimizing environmental impact. When choosing, always check product labels for environmental certifications and application guidelines to make sure you're using the most sustainable solution.
